Carlos Lazo
Carlos Lazo is a locality in Saltillo, Coahuila and has an elevation of 1,665 metres. Carlos Lazo is situated nearby to the locality Privada Fray Landín Ampliación, as well as near Los Fundadores.Places in the Area

Saltillo is the capital of Coahuila state. Saltillo is a beautiful colonial city in Northern Mexico. It is a traditional city with a colorful history. Interior designers know Saltillo for its famous thick, lightly glazed, earthen ceramic floor tiles, and the brightly colored shawls known as sarapes are part of the city's colorful tradition.
